About us:

For more than a century UofL Health Shelbyville Hospital has served the people of Shelby and surrounding counties with highquality health care. In 2019 the hospital joined the newly formed UofL Health becoming UofL Health Shelbyville Hospital. Colonel Harland Sanders stands tall at the front entrance to greet guests. In appreciation for a generous gift from the Canadianbased Colonel Harland Sanders Charitable Foundation the hospital gave honor by naming the campus Harland D. Sanders Medical Campus.

Job Summary

The patient care assistant provides clinical patient care support in a caring safe and efficient manner under the supervision and delegation of the Registered Nurse. In collaboration with patients and families (as defined by the patient) the patient care assistant is responsible for the care of the patient. The patient care assistant adheres to and is supportive of the hospital and the department of Nursing mission and philosophy.

Delivers outstanding service to our internal and external customer by advocating for customers preferences; maximizing communication and partnering with peers and customers; acting to obtain feedback problem solving and change; demonstrating zest through integrity punctuality appearance and style.

Some Primary Responsibilities:

  • Performs functional assignments per unit standards of care including such activities as patient admission and discharge procedures unit environmental organizational tasks.
  • Performs and documents patient mobility and exercise comfort rest sleep and care needs patient hygiene grooming dressing skincare dietary toileting and elimination needs.
